The document discusses instructional planning activity types that can help teachers develop curriculum-based technological pedagogical content knowledge (TPACK). It describes five steps of the planning process: choosing learning goals, making pedagogical decisions, selecting and sequencing activity types, selecting assessments, and choosing tools. Learning activity types represent what students do during learning and can be combined into lesson plans, units or projects. The document advocates for standards-based, student-centered planning rather than a technocentric approach that focuses on technologies over student learning needs.
